The Bently Nevada 991-06-XX-01-00 169955-01 Thrust Transmitter is an industrial axial position monitoring device used for measuring thrust displacement of rotating machinery shafts. It receives signals from compatible displacement probes and converts them into standardized monitoring outputs for integration with plant control and machinery protection systems.
In large rotating equipment, axial shaft movement must be controlled within a specific operating range. Excessive thrust displacement may result from thrust bearing wear, rotor movement, alignment problems, or mechanical degradation. The 991-06-XX-01-00 transmitter provides continuous thrust position monitoring to help operators identify abnormal mechanical conditions before serious equipment damage occurs.
The transmitter is part of Bently Nevada’s machinery condition monitoring product family and is commonly applied in turbines, compressors, pumps, and other critical rotating equipment. It provides a compact field-level monitoring solution for applications requiring reliable thrust position measurement.
| Parameter | Specification |
|---|---|
| Manufacturer | Bently Nevada |
| Model | 991-06-XX-01-00 |
| Part Number | 169955-01 |
| Product Type | Thrust Transmitter |
| Function | Axial Position / Thrust Displacement Monitoring |
| Application | Rotating Machinery Condition Monitoring |
| Measurement Type | Shaft Axial Position |
| Installation | Industrial Field Mounting |
| Dimensions | 100.1 × 73.9 × 53.3 mm |
| Weight | 0.43 kg |

The Bently Nevada 991-06-XX-01-00 operates by processing displacement signals from a connected thrust position probe.
Typical signal flow:
Rotating Shaft → Thrust Position Probe → 991-06-XX-01-00 Transmitter → Monitoring System
